Rusike on the double for Team of Choice

Cape Town - Maritzburg United maintained their winning start to the new Premiership season by beating Ajax Cape Town 2-0 at Harry Gwala Stadium on Wednesday.

Lebohang Maboe and Siphesihle Ndlovu squandered early chances for the hosts, while Tashreeq Morris wastefully headed over the visitors' best chance of the half after 15 minutes.

United went ahead on the half-hour mark when Bandile Shandu's brilliant ball from the right was nodded in by Evans Rusike at the near post.

The Zimbabwean had three more opportunities to double their lead going into the break. He twice shot wide, before drawing a flying one-handed save out of Brandon Petersen.

Thabo Mosadi had an excellent chance to draw level after the restart, but after capitalising on some poor defending, he was denied by an excellent point-blank save by Bongani Mpandle.

It was a vital intervention for Maritzburg, who scored with their next chance as Rusike beat a defender outside the box and ran in towards goal, before coolly finishing.

Fortune Makaringe then drew another good diving save from Petersen as the pressure continued, but there were no more goals needed for the hosts as they sealed the win.
